Orioles Singing in the Willows is a picturesque park ensemble stretching along the southeastern shore of the famous West Lake (Xihu) in Hangzhou, China. This site is rightfully ranked among the "Ten Scenes of West Lake," offering visitors a chance to immerse themselves in the atmosphere of a classic Chinese landscape celebrated by poets for centuries.

The park's main attraction is its endless rows of weeping willows, whose branches sway gracefully in the breeze, creating a "green veil" effect. In spring, as nature awakens, orioles begin to sing among the foliage, giving the place its poetic name. The 20-hectare area is divided into several themed zones, including cherry blossom gardens and spacious lawns for relaxation.
The park attracts tourists with its tranquil atmosphere and panoramic views of the lake. Here, you can encounter squirrels, admire elegant sculptures, and experience the harmony of nature in the heart of the bustling Shangcheng District.
